What Is Psychedelic Therapy?

Psychedelic therapy is a form of mental health treatment that uses small, controlled doses of psychedelic substances—such as psilocybin (found in magic mushrooms), ketamine, or MDMA—combined with psychotherapy. These substances temporarily change the way the brain processes emotions and thoughts, allowing patients to access memories, patterns, and feelings that are normally suppressed.

During therapy, the mind becomes more flexible, open, and connected. This helps patients process trauma or emotional blockages that may have caused long-term mental health issues.

When guided by trained medical professionals, psychedelic therapy can help “reset” negative mental loops and allow the brain to form new, healthier connections. The experience is deeply personal, introspective, and healing when done safely.

How Psychedelic Therapy Works

Psychedelic therapy is not a single session. It’s a structured, multi-step process designed for safety, comfort, and emotional integration.

1. Initial Consultation

Before therapy begins, patients meet with a mental health professional who reviews their medical history, emotional background, and treatment goals. This helps determine if psychedelic therapy is suitable for them.

2. Preparation Sessions

Patients are guided through relaxation techniques, mindfulness, and goal-setting exercises. This preparation ensures the mind is calm and ready for introspection during the actual session.

3. Supervised Psychedelic Session

The session takes place in a comfortable, controlled environment. The patient receives a carefully measured dose of the psychedelic medicine while being monitored by a licensed therapist or medical team. Calming music, eye masks, or breathing exercises are often used to help focus inward.

During this time, emotions, memories, and sensations may surface. The therapist offers gentle guidance, ensuring safety and emotional stability throughout the experience.

4. Integration Therapy

After the psychedelic experience, integration sessions help the patient reflect on what they discovered. These follow-up discussions are essential, as they help transform new insights into lasting emotional growth and behavioral change.

Through this process, patients often gain new perspectives, forgive themselves or others, and rebuild self-compassion and resilience.

Safety and Legality

In Canada, psychedelic-assisted therapy is offered legally through specific programs and under medical approval. Health Canada allows certain clinics and professionals to use substances like psilocybin and ketamine for treatment-resistant depression and other conditions.

Is Psychedelic Therapy Right for You?

Psychedelic therapy may be a good option if you:

  • Have depression, anxiety, or PTSD that doesn’t improve with regular medication

  • Feel emotionally blocked or disconnected

  • Struggle with past trauma or grief

  • Want to explore self-awareness and emotional healing

  • Are ready to approach therapy with openness and trust

However, it’s not suitable for everyone. People with a history of certain mental disorders (like schizophrenia) or uncontrolled health conditions should discuss risks with their doctor first. That’s why it’s important to work with qualified professionals who can provide personalized guidance.
